Viva Jo Dozier "Mommie Jo", 78, of Nashville, formerly of Dyersburg, passed away on Monday, June 16, 2014 at her residence.
She was the owner and operator of Apartment Staffing of Nashville and a Baptist. Ms. Viva was a former member of the Dyersburg-Dyer County Red Cross Chapter and a former Red Hat Lady. She was the former manager of The Greentree Apartments in Dyersburg and was an entrepreneur. She was deeply loved and touched many lives and will be missed by many. Ms. Viva was one of a kind.
